Output 15c89cf829c77804fc7913e3c631007e5c0ceeaab6680bd5b1b3aa421895aa7f:0

value
37440145
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d2ac9e3fc07d0cb9fd16633b319d1f5db6bf175 OP_EQUALVERIFY OP_CHECKSIG
address
13fDra31fojTmU3RbhQ5gmE264Ky6kpiW3
transaction
15c89cf829c77804fc7913e3c631007e5c0ceeaab6680bd5b1b3aa421895aa7f
spent
true